Update on the little Black girl dog from Victorville (Luna). So once we picked up Luna from Corona Pet Medical Center we had rushed her to our Vet (OC Vet Hospital) where she underwent further tests. She was acting very lethargic and appeared to be in distress and had diarrhea. She tested negative for Parvo originally from Corona Vet and once she arrived to our Vet she was administered another ELISA test which she still tested negative. But our doctor felt she had all the symptoms of Parvo and decided to hospitalize her and get on an IV to get her hydrated. The next day they decided to run a PCR test which revealed she did in fact have Parvo and started her on meds. Fortunately it was a low grade and due to her age (not being a puppy) her prognosis is good. Today we are super happy to report she is off IV and is eating and drinking on her own. Her stools are looking really good too. So thankful for Dr. Horn’s determination of getting to the bottom of her ailments and a proper diagnosis. She is in really good spirits and will stay in quarantine for the next two weeks. She is such a sweet girl.
